A great effort from us last night. The Villa game was so disappointing so I wasn’t expecting much. No Vydra, JRod dropped and 2 keepers on the bench. I thought Sean was manoeuvring his exit.
Wolves started very sharply, but we didn’t panic and slowly started to take the game to them. Barnes should have opened the scoring when put through, but made up for it with a good header from Taylor’s sublime cross. Brownhill unlucky with the free kick. We came out really well in the second half. Scored and were well in control, until the slight hiccup at the end.
Pope – 7 – Can only be beaten from the penalty spot these days. Not much to do.
Lowton – 7 – Tried to go forward whenever he could – defensively ok
Tarkowski - 9 – Excellent, calm and worryingly proficient for potential watching suitors
Mee - 9 – Total commitment from Ben. He must be feeling beaten up today, but a great performance
Taylor - 9 – He’s been off the pace a bit this season, but excellent today – what a great cross for Barnes
Brady – 7 – Did pretty well – Could try to beat the full back occasionally, but good control overall
Brownhill - 8 – Much improved on the Villa game – great freekick and unlucky to hit the bar. Just needs to stop giving the ball away cheaply at times
Westwood – 8 – Better from Ashley in forward mode. Pick up a lot of second balls and some good passes
McNeil – 7 – Worked very hard, but couldn’t find the break or pass to hurt Wolves
Wood – 8 – Sharp finish and unlucky with a moment of great control and shot well saved.
Barnes – 7 – He really wanted it tonight. Much better when he stays on his feet. There’s a time for winning cheap fouls, but he looks for it too often at time.
JRod – 6
Pieters - 6
